A Role of the UN in Negotiating Peace

The UN plays a crucial role in peace negotiations around the globe, acting as a intermediary and enabler in disputes that endanger global stability. Established to advance peace and security, the UN provides a venue for dialogue between conflicting parties. Through its dedicated agencies and peacekeeping missions, it helps to foster an environment conducive to negotiations, ensuring that all perspectives are heard and taken into account.

In addition to facilitation, the United Nations also offers specialized and logistical support during negotiations for peace. This includes organizing summits, providing expertise on resolving conflicts, and ensuring the participation of diverse participants, including governments, NGOs, and civil society. By cultivating alliances and building collaborations, the United Nations strengthens diplomatic ties that are necessary for sustainable peace.

Furthermore, the effectiveness of the UN in peace negotiations is often improved by its credibility and authority derived from laws on the international stage. Decisions passed by the General Assembly and the Security Council of the UN carry significant weight, encouraging nations to participate in discussions and follow agreements. The United Nations’ dedication to uphold human rights and promote development further adds to its role as a reliable partner in addressing the root causes of conflict, ultimately aiming for lasting global resolution of conflicts.
